For now there are two methods: - `NETWORK:IsUrlAllowed()`: Check whether access to a certain URL is allowed. - `NETWORK:HttpRequest()`: Perform an HTTP request. By default access to the network is disabled for all target hosts. It can be enabled by setting `HttpEnable=1` in the preferences. Individual hosts have to be added to `HttpAllowHosts` as a comma separated list to allow access. See included docs for more details on usage.
